The Walmart boycott has begun in the United States! Who's organizing it and why?

On Monday, April 7th, a Walmart boycott will begin in the United States. The protest, which will last until Monday, April 14th, in all of the chain’s stores, is organized by a group called People’s Union USA, which accuses the company of going against diversity. Here’s what we know about it.

Why was the Walmart boycott organized?

The Walmart boycott comes after the supermarket chain decided to end its diversity programs in 2024 by canceling the funding for its racial equity center, suspending training on this topic, and halting its participation in the Human Rights Campaign’s Corporate Equality Index.

This move was not well received by some organizations, such as People’s Union USA, which also accused Walmart of corporate greed and political corruption, and of becoming a symbol of all the mistakes within corporate power in the country.

“Our mission is simple: we want these corporations to start paying their fair share of taxes so that Americans can finally be relieved from the burden of the federal income tax,” said John Schwarz, founder of People’s Union USA, in a statement.

Which Walmart stores will be part of the boycott?

The Walmart boycott urges consumers to refrain from shopping at any of the chain’s stores from April 7 to April 14, including both physical and online stores. The boycott includes the following stores:

  • Walmart stores: Supercenters, Neighborhood Markets, and Sam’s Club gas stations.
  • Online purchases: Walmart website, Walmart+ subscription, and delivery services.
  • Walmart brands: Great Value, Equate, Mainstays, George, and Parent’s Choice.

How will the boycott affect Walmart?

On February 28th, Walmart also faced a boycott that led to a 9% drop in online store traffic and a 5% decline in physical store visits. It is expected that this boycott will also cause a significant drop in sales.

Upcoming scheduled boycotts in the United States

The Walmart boycott will not be the only one in the United States, as People’s Union USA has posted a schedule of planned economic protests on its website for the coming months, which includes major companies such as Amazon, McDonald’s, and General Mills.

The boycott could also include PepsiCo, as Al Sharpton, founder of the National Action Network, has requested a meeting with the company to discuss the restoration of DEI programs, or else he would call for a protest against the company.

Here’s the schedule of planned boycotts in the United States:

  • April 18: Economic Blackout 2
  • April 21-28: Boycott of General Mills
  • May 6-12: Boycott of Amazon 2
  • May 20-26: Boycott of Walmart 2
  • June 3-9: Boycott of Target
  • June 24-30: Boycott of McDonald’s
  • July 4: Boycott for Independence Day

What is People’s Union USA?

According to the description on its website, People’s Union USA is a grassroots movement focused on economic resistance, corporate accountability, and real justice for the working class. It is not a political party, but a movement for the people, regardless of their background, beliefs, or affiliation.

The movement was created with the mission of uniting everyday Americans against the greed and corruption that have kept them divided, distracted, and struggling for decades.
